Spanning 1,998 square feet of heated living space, the Contemporary House Plan is engineered for narrow-lot configurations with its efficient 30-foot width and 80-foot depth. This single-level residence prioritizes spatial clarity through a linear arrangement, utilizing a 6:12 roof pitch and a total building height of 28 feet to maintain a clean, modern silhouette. The front elevation is defined by a 27-square-foot covered porch that provides a subtle entry transition, keeping the facade balanced and understated.
The interior core features an open-concept layout where the kitchen, dining, and keeping room share a common axis. By integrating the kitchen island and eating bar, the design maintains clear sightlines across the central living zones. A walk-in pantry is located adjacent to the kitchen to consolidate storage, while the 9-foot ceilings throughout the home contribute to a consistent sense of volume and scale. The inclusion of a flexible room allows for a dedicated home office or study, providing adaptability within the 1,998-square-foot footprint.
A split-bedroom layout ensures the primary suite remains private, separated from the secondary bedrooms by the central living core. The primary suite includes a walk-in closet and a full bathroom with dual vanity sinks. Two additional bedrooms are positioned for convenient access to the remaining bathrooms, supporting a 4-bedroom, 3-bath configuration that serves diverse household needs. A dedicated laundry room is also situated on the main floor to streamline residential maintenance.
Construction specifications include a slab foundation and 2x4 wall framing, paired with a truss roof system for structural efficiency. The attached 684-square-foot two-car garage provides direct access to the interior, keeping the exterior footprint compact. A 300-square-foot rear porch extends the living area outdoors, offering a sheltered exterior zone that complements the interior floor plan.

Choose a building foundation for your home. The foundation provides stability to a home's structure from the ground up.
Slab - This concrete foundation is reinforced with steel rods and suitable for flat ground.
Crawl Space - This foundation is raised off the ground with low walls resting on footings, providing space for wiring, plumbing, and storage.
Basement - This foundation is entirely or partially below ground and offers storage or living areas.
Walkout Basement - This foundation is typically suited for rear-sloping lots and provides storage or living areas. Walkout basements have doors that provide access to the outside.
